This two-day course follows on from the National Powerboat Certificate (also known as Level 2). We will develop your basic driving skills in more complex situations and weather permitting, include an introduction to rough water boat handling. You’ll be introduced to basic navigation and pilotage, as well as planning a day trip. Sessions will also be run on the use of compasses, GPS and VHF radio, personal safety and dealing with emergency situations such as engine failure, fire and recovering someone who has fallen overboard.
The course also focus’ on navigational excercises, pre-planned in the class room you will have the ability to navigate safely around the coast, understanding weather, tides, pilotage and utisiling charts. During the two days you will have the opportunity to plan your own passage from Fowey to Polperro, Looe or Mevagissey.
Pre-course experience: you should be competent to Powerboat Level 2 with coastal endorsement
